Four arrested in Oakland robbery spree

Police captured four suspects in a string of nine armed robberies committed within two hours across a large area of Oakland Monday afternoon, a police captain said on Tuesday.

The suspects were caught after leading officers on a brief pursuit in a stolen car, police Capt. Steven Tull said.

The armed robberies were all reported between 12:48 p.m. and 2:46 p.m., Tull said.

They were at 3465 Brookdale Ave., 4200 Boston Ave., 4058 Lyon Ave., Laguna Avenue and MacArthur Boulevard, 3026 57th Ave., 3300 E. 16th St., 506 E. 19th St., Bayview Avenue and Elliot Street and at 2914 56th Ave., according to Tull.

Officers were able to track the victim’s cellphone in the first robbery, eventually leading them to the stolen car.

The suspects briefly fled from officers but were swiftly captured, Tull said.
